Abstract
In 2006 the new Middle School Building on the campus of Sidwell Friends School in Washington DC was completed at a cost of $28 million. The project is a renovation and addition to a fifty-year-old educational facility transforming the building and the surrounding landscape into a green expression of the school’s ambition to create a teaching landscape in close connection to the natural environment. The project designed by KieranTimberlake Associates was awarded LEED Platinum certification, making it the first school for this age group (8-12) in the United States to receive platinum rating.
